Re: High throughput switches...

2011-05-19 Thread James Harr
Bonding usually involves some sort of flow-based hashing mechanism for balancing across the links. The logic behind it being that reordering TCP packets (among other things) negates the benefit of the aggregation in CPU costs and retransmissions.
